Man who appeared to be planning theft arrested


UNION-TRIBUNE

7:13 a.m. August 19, 2008

CHULA VISTA: A 28-year-old man was arrested last night inside a recycling yard, where he was believed to have been stacking copper wiring to steal, police said. A employee at a neighboring business called police about 7:40 p.m. to report seeing a man hop a fence into Mike's Recycling on Main Street, Chula Vista police Sgt. John McAvenia said.

Officers surrounded the yard and Officer Joel Monreal and his canine partner, Lucas, began searching inside. The dog started barking at some bales of crushed aluminum cans and the intruder stepped out and surrendered, McAvenia said.

Police found about 30 pounds of copper wiring piled up near the fence.
